Additional Info
Includes
- Any cause, including deconditioning, disuse (e.g. due to prolonged bedrest, or after a stroke), Malnutrition, etc
- Sarcopenia-age related progressive loss of muscle mass and strength
- To code muscle weakness due to an active Covid infection, where this is the only evidence of the infection, use codes: Muscle, wasting/atrophy NOS, with COVID-19 (SARS-COV-2), and Carrier of infectious disease, unspecified

Guidelines for Acquired neuromuscular weakness
- Many acutely ill (especially critically ill) patients develop/acquire weakness while in hospital
- But, there are a variety of different causes of such weakness, including related to problems with nerves (neuropathies) and muscles (myopathies). While there are some ways to distinguish among these (e.g. use of EMG/NCV testing) this is almost never done because other than avoidance, there are no real treatments for any of these, i.e. they're all treated with rehabilitation.
- Here are the specific diagnostic codes we have to cover these various causes:
- Acquired neuropathies:
- Acquired myopathies:
- Muscle, wasting/atrophy NOS -- this INCLUDES weakness/wasting/atrophy due to deconditioning
- Myopathy, drug-induced
- Muscle disorder/myopathy (primary or secondary), NOS
- Muscle, disorder NOS
- When it's not even clear whether the problem is due to muscle or nerves
